Output 7d52ac34ca7a3fae4871fe0b461aa153bb1d962b8c94112b11226222ddd7677f:2

value
15000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 70144ee99dd1ae9818007257085a1634233fdd86 OP_EQUAL
address
3Budw54dXjo17fyaBkjxSPHpPyjRmUbVU4
transaction
7d52ac34ca7a3fae4871fe0b461aa153bb1d962b8c94112b11226222ddd7677f
confirmations
301537
spent
true